Lee Vue
Lee Vue is a storyteller, communication strategist, nonprofit leader, and passionate advocate for social impact with a heart for empowering others. Her drive comes from transformative experiences in youth leadership programs and outdoor adventures—whether paddling the entire Mississippi River or wandering the Canadian tundra, where she was lucky enough to spot caribou, arctic foxes, and ptarmigans (but no polar bears, thank goodness).
Born and raised in Fresno, CA, Lee grew up roaming farmlands and fields while her parents worked alongside undocumented families, shaping her deep appreciation for community and resilience.
Her career spans startups, academic institutions, nonprofits, and consulting, all with a personal mission to transform systems for the better.
When she's not crafting strategies for clients, you'll find her teaching BIPOC communities how to paddle and expanding access to the Boundary Waters Canoe Area. Above all, Lee is passionate about helping girls break through the barriers of circumstance and embrace the endless potential they hold.
